The Heartwarming Story of Waitress on Stage

Waitress tells the poignant and often humorous story of Jenna Hunterson, a waitress and expert pie maker in a small town who dreams of a way out of her difficult life. Trapped in an unfulfilling marriage, Jenna finds solace and self-expression through her extraordinary pies, each a unique creation reflecting her inner turmoil and desires. When an unexpected baking contest offers her a chance at freedom, Jenna must muster the courage to change her life, finding strength in her friendships and discovering her own secret recipe for happiness. The narrative, adapted from Adrienne Shelly's beloved film, is brought to vibrant life through a book by Jessie Nelson and an absolutely unforgettable score by Grammy-nominated artist Sara Bareilles. From the intricate character arcs to the beautifully crafted emotional moments, Waitress is a masterclass in storytelling that resonates deeply with anyone who has ever dreamed of a better tomorrow. The Unforgettable Music of Sara Bareilles

Central to the magic of Waitress is its breathtaking original score, penned by the immensely talented singer-songwriter Sara Bareilles. Her music, a harmonious blend of pop, folk, and classic musical theater styles, is deeply woven into the narrative, providing not just accompaniment but integral character development and emotional depth. Songs like the soaring "She Used to Be Mine" encapsulate Jenna's longing and resilience, while "What Baking Can Do" perfectly illustrates her creative outlet and inner world. The witty ensemble numbers such as "Bad Idea" and the charming duets further showcase Bareilles's lyrical prowess and melodic genius. Every song in Waitress serves a distinct purpose, driving the plot forward while simultaneously delving into the hearts and minds of its characters.
